Output cdca7cbc77376bb4fbb167c39fb5d2aa30ac28c99d5040724fdb8a034baf13c3:0

value
87803991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1ea7ca328ad36511f325c7e4fde85bb49cc5e9 OP_EQUAL
address
3HZgDu5op3ezDza5xfVXw8RqPje6zxUE4s
transaction
cdca7cbc77376bb4fbb167c39fb5d2aa30ac28c99d5040724fdb8a034baf13c3
confirmations
28941
spent
true